Question

Je cherche à suivre un dossier pour créer des événements en utilisant le FileSystemWatcher en c #. Le problème est qu'un autre processus 3ème partie surveille également ce dossier, j'ai besoin (si possible) pour mon processus pour recevoir le créer un événement avant que le processus 3ème partie.

Est-il possible dans le code managé ou non managé que je peux donner mon processus une priorité plus élevée?

Était-ce utile?

La solution

Même si vous donnez votre application une priorité plus élevée, il n'y a aucune garantie que votre demande recevra le premier événement. Même si vous faites la promotion de votre application à la plus haute priorité, à un moment donné, l'autre application obtenir une tranche de temps de traitement et il pourrait recevoir l'événement alors.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top